1973 mercury 650 65 hp...........i took the control box apart then back together(without aligning anything but the screwholes) now it wont start???????????????argh please help?
 

heybaylor

Petty Officer 2nd Class
Joined
Jan 17, 2005
Messages
187
Re: Throttle Control Box

you have the shifter cam out of position .<br />the neutral switch is not made..<br />or the ignition switch is bad.<br />that is if no start means the engine will not crank over
